Anger cultivates adversaries
And corrupts the heart and soul.
Intolerance grows like a clinging vine from this poison.
Are we so bold as to think ourselves above another,
The epitome of a self-righteous god?
Enemies will sprout from every dispute if this be true,
Of this I am confident.
Correct thinking and love are our allies,
Understanding this, is a sign of wisdom.
.
~~ Dominic R. DiFrancesco ~~
